Garland Soil Conditions & Foundation Requirements

Geotechnical Characteristics

Dallas County Eagle Ford clay common throughout Garland. Active zone typically 6-8 feet. Eastern areas near Lake Ray Hubbard may have water table considerations. Geotechnical investigation required for commercial foundation design.

Critical for Garland Developers

Always commission a geotechnical investigation before designing foundations in Garland. Soil conditions can vary dramatically even within the same development. We coordinate with your geotechnical engineer to ensure foundation systems are properly designed for actual site conditions—not generic assumptions that lead to costly failures.

Garland Building Department Coordination

City of Garland Development Services

Established city department handling commercial permit volume. Projects require structural engineer seal, geotechnical reports, and special inspection agreements. City follows IBC/IRC codes with local amendments.

Typical Garland Commercial Permit Requirements:

  • • Structural drawings stamped by Texas Professional Engineer (PE)
  • • Geotechnical investigation report with bearing capacity recommendations
  • • Shop drawings for tilt-wall panels, post-tension slabs, or specialty concrete
  • • Third-party special inspection agreements (tilt-wall, PT, high-strength concrete)
  • • Concrete mix designs meeting ACI 318 and city specifications
  • • Site development plans with drainage and utility coordination
